Photo Stencil hosts stencil technology and design workshops
Mar 14, 2006
Photo Stencil, a leading provider of premium stencils and additional high-end tooling for the SMT assembly industry, announces its 2006 workshop schedule. The workshops provide information on stencil printing performance and how stencil technology and stencil design influences stencil printing performance. Data generated by independent test laboratories during print performance studies, as well as the expertise of Dr. Bill Coleman, vice president of technology at Photo Stencil, and Mike Burgess, Photo Stencil's stencil product manager, combine to provide an excellent source of information for printing solutions. "Our ultimate goal is to help the industry," says Dr. Coleman. "These workshops are one way that we can leverage our extensive knowledge of printing processes and tools to give our current and prospective customers a competitive advantage." These hands-on workshops are targeted to process and quality control engineers, supervisors, managers and technicians who are involved with solder-paste screen printing, process control, solder paste selection and the assembly process. The workshops will be held on March 17, April 21, May 26, June 23, July 21, August 25, September 22, October 27 and November 17.
